The angle between the pair of lines whose equation is `4x^(2)+10xy+my^(2)+5x+10y=0`, is

A

`tan^(-1)(3//8)`

B

`tan^(-1)(3//4)`

C

`tan^(-1)(2sqrt(25-4m)//m+4),m in R`

D

none of the above

Text Solution

Verified by Experts

The correct Answer is:
B

Condition for pair of lines , `abc+2fgh-af^2-bg^2-ch^2=0`
`therefore 4xxmxx0+2xx5xx(5)/(2)xx5-4(5)^2-m((5)/(2))^2-0(5)^2=0`
`125-100-(25m)/(4)=0rArr m=4`
Now, the angle between lines is. `tantheta=(2sqrt(h^2-ab))/(a+b)=(2sqrt(25-16))/(8)`
`rArr tan theta =(3)/(4)rArr theta=^(-1)(3)/(4)`
